Both groups will receive the same total volume and concentration of local anesthetic. The primary outcome will be the highest resting Numeric Rating Scale pain score recorded during the first 24 postoperative hours. Secondary outcomes will include block performance time, sensory block success in suprascapular and axillary nerve territories, opioid consumption, time to rescue analgesia, motor function, diaphragmatic function, postoperative recovery quality, patient satisfaction, and block-related complications.",[28,29],"Postoperative Pain","Shoulder Arthroscopy",[31,32,33,34,35,36,37,38],"Diaphragm-sparing block","Postoperative analgesia","Regional anesthesia","Axillary nerve block","Suprascapular nerve block","Shoulder arthroscopy","Shoulder Posterior Pericapsular Nerve Group block","SPENG block","NOT_YET_RECRUITING","2026-08-12",{"date":42,"type":43},"2026-08-14","ACTUAL",{"date":45,"type":22},"2026-11-01",{"date":47,"type":22},"2027-06-15",{"name":49,"class":50},"Izmir City Hospital","OTHER_GOV",{"id":52,"slug":53,"hasResults":11,"nctId":54,"briefTitle":55,"officialTitle":55,"acronym":4,"eligibilityCriteria":56,"healthyVolunteers":11,"sex":17,"minAge":18,"maxAge":4,"enrollmentInfo":57,"targetDuration":4,"studyType":23,"phases":59,"briefSummary":60,"conditions":61,"keywords":4,"overallStatus":39,"whyStopped":4,"lastUpdateSubmitDate":62,"lastUpdatePostDateStruct":63,"startDateStruct":65,"completionDateStruct":67,"leadSponsor":69,"locationsCount":4},"100648785","use-of-a-smartphone-app-to-support-pre--and-post-surgical-preparedness-and-to-improve-clinical-outcomes-in-patients-undergoing-shoulder-arthroscopy-100648785","NCT07725224","Use of a Smartphone App to Support Pre- and Post-Surgical Preparedness and to Improve Clinical Outcomes in Patients Undergoing Shoulder Arthroscopy","Inclusion Criteria:\n\n* scheduled for shoulder arthroscopy with participating surgeon\n\nExclusion Criteria:\n\n\\-",{"count":58,"type":22},100,[25],"This study is testing whether a smartphone app can help patients better follow instructions before and after shoulder surgery, compared to the usual paper instructions.\n\nPeople from all backgrounds sometimes have trouble understanding or remembering everything needed to prepare for surgery and recover safely - things like when to stop certain medications, how to shower with a special soap before surgery, or how to care for a wound afterward. Missing these steps can lead to surgery being delayed or canceled, or to problems during recovery. These difficulties can be greater for patients facing barriers such as limited health information, language differences, or lack of support at home.\n\nThis study includes adults having planned shoulder arthroscopy (a type of shoulder surgery) at Johns Hopkins. Participants will be randomly assigned to one of two groups: one will receive the standard printed instructions currently used in clinic, and the other will receive the same instructions through an app on the smartphone. The app also pulls basic information from the patient's electronic health record - surgery type, date, surgeon, and medications - so instructions can be tailored to each patient. Refusal to undergo interscalene block.",{"count":81,"type":22},50,[25],"Ultrasound-guided interscalene block is commonly used for postoperative analgesia in patients undergoing shoulder arthroscopy. The location of local anesthetic injection may influence both block efficacy and the incidence of block-related complications. This randomized, double-blind clinical trial compares two different injection sites around the C5-C7 nerve roots using the same local anesthetic dose and volume. The study will assess block success, postoperative analgesia, opioid consumption, diaphragmatic function, and procedure-related complications.",[29,28],[86,87,88,29,89,90,91,92],"Ultrasound-Guided Interscalene Block","Interscalene Block","Regional Anesthesia","Postoperative Analgesia","Local Anesthetic","Brachial Plexus Block","Phrenic Nerve","2026-07-05",{"date":95,"type":43},"2026-07-10",{"date":97,"type":22},"2026-07-15",{"date":99,"type":22},"2026-11-30",{"name":101,"class":71},"Sultan Abdulhamid Han Training and Research Hospital, Istanbul, Turkey",1,{"id":104,"slug":105,"hasResults":11,"nctId":106,"briefTitle":107,"officialTitle":108,"acronym":109,"eligibilityCriteria":110,"healthyVolunteers":11,"sex":17,"minAge":18,"maxAge":111,"enrollmentInfo":112,"targetDuration":4,"studyType":23,"phases":114,"briefSummary":115,"conditions":116,"keywords":117,"overallStatus":121,"whyStopped":4,"lastUpdateSubmitDate":122,"lastUpdatePostDateStruct":123,"startDateStruct":125,"completionDateStruct":126,"leadSponsor":128,"locationsCount":102},"100644008","interscalene-brachial-plexus-block-versus-serratus-posterior-superior-intercostal-plane-block-for-arthroscopic-shoulder-surgery-100644008","NCT07668648","Interscalene Brachial Plexus Block Versus Serratus Posterior Superior Intercostal Plane Block for Arthroscopic Shoulder Surgery","Comparison of Interscalene Brachial Plexus Block and Serratus Posterior Superior Intercostal Plane Block for Postoperative Analgesia After Arthroscopic Shoulder Surgery: A Prospective, Randomized, Double-Blind Controlled Trial","SISA","Inclusion Criteria:\n\n* Age between 18 and 75 years\n* ASA physical status I, II, or III\n* Scheduled for elective arthroscopic shoulder surgery under general anesthesia\n* Provision of written informed consent\n\nExclusion Criteria:\n\n* Refusal to participate in the study\n* Coagulopathy\n* Current anticoagulant therapy\n* Infection at the block site\n* Previous surgery involving the planned block site\n* Known allergy or history of toxicity to local anesthetics\n* Hepatic failure\n* Renal failure\n* Uncontrolled diabetes mellitus\n* Cognitive impairment or mental disability preventing reliable assessment\n* Chronic opioid use or ongoing chronic pain treatment\n* Pregnancy, suspected pregnancy, or breastfeeding\n* Chronic pulmonary disease (e.g., COPD or asthma)\n* Failed block","75 Years",{"count":113,"type":22},80,[25],"Arthroscopic shoulder surgery is associated with moderate to severe postoperative pain that may delay recovery and rehabilitation. Interscalene brachial plexus block (ISB) is widely used for postoperative analgesia in shoulder surgery; however, it may be associated with complications such as phrenic nerve paralysis. The serratus posterior superior intercostal plane (SPSIP) block is a recently described fascial plane block that may provide effective analgesia while avoiding some of the limitations of ISB.\n\nThis prospective, randomized, double-blind controlled trial aims to compare the analgesic efficacy of ISB and SPSIP block in patients undergoing elective arthroscopic shoulder surgery under general anesthesia. The primary outcome is total postoperative opioid consumption during the first 24 hours after surgery. Secondary outcomes include postoperative pain scores, quality of recovery, time to first rescue analgesia, rescue analgesic requirements, intraoperative opioid consumption, sensory block distribution, motor block characteristics, and block-related complications.",[28,29],[118,119,88,120],"Interscalene Brachial Plexus Block","Serratus Posterior Superior Intercostal Plane Block","Ultrasound-Guided Nerve Block","RECRUITING","2026-06-25",{"date":124,"type":43},"2026-06-29",{"date":122,"type":43},{"date":127,"type":22},"2026-12-15",{"name":129,"class":50},"Ferit Yetik",{"id":131,"slug":132,"hasResults":11,"nctId":133,"briefTitle":134,"officialTitle":135,"acronym":4,"eligibilityCriteria":136,"healthyVolunteers":11,"sex":17,"minAge":18,"maxAge":137,"enrollmentInfo":138,"targetDuration":4,"studyType":23,"phases":140,"briefSummary":141,"conditions":142,"keywords":143,"overallStatus":39,"whyStopped":4,"lastUpdateSubmitDate":148,"lastUpdatePostDateStruct":149,"startDateStruct":151,"completionDateStruct":153,"leadSponsor":155,"locationsCount":102},"100621334","continuous-cervical-erector-spinae-plane-block-versus-interscalene-nerve-block-in-shoulder-arthroscopic-surgery-100621334","NCT07369271","Continuous Cervical Erector Spinae Plane Block Versus Interscalene Nerve Block in Shoulder Arthroscopic Surgery","Continuous Cervical Erector Spinae Plane Block Versus Interscalene Nerve Block in Shoulder Arthroscopic Surgery- A Randomized Controlled Trial","Inclusion Criteria:\n\n* Adult patients scheduled for elective shoulder arthroscopic surgery\n\nExclusion Criteria:\n\n* Contraindications to regional analgesia\n* BMI \\>40\n* ASA physical status IV\n* history of drug or opioid abuse\n* preoperative upper limb motor impairment\n* postoperative ventilator support or ICU admission\n* Inability to provide self-reported pain assessments","80 Years",{"count":139,"type":22},165,[25],"Shoulder arthroscopic surgery is associated with moderate to severe postoperative pain, which may hinder early mobilization and functional recovery. Interscalene block (ISB) is commonly used to provide effective analgesia but is frequently associated with hemidiaphragmatic paralysis due to phrenic nerve involvement. Cervical erector spinae plane block (ESPB) has been proposed as an alternative regional technique that may provide analgesia while reducing respiratory-related adverse effects. This randomized controlled trial aims to compare the analgesic efficacy and safety of cervical ESPB versus continuous ISB in patients undergoing shoulder arthroscopic surgery.",[29],[36,144,145,146,147],"postoperative pain","regional anesthesia","interscalene block","erector spinae plane block","2026-01-17",{"date":150,"type":43},"2026-01-27",{"date":152,"type":22},"2026-01-15",{"date":154,"type":22},"2028-01-31",{"name":156,"class":71},"National Cheng-Kung University Hospital",{"id":158,"slug":159,"hasResults":11,"nctId":160,"briefTitle":161,"officialTitle":162,"acronym":4,"eligibilityCriteria":163,"healthyVolunteers":11,"sex":17,"minAge":18,"maxAge":111,"enrollmentInfo":164,"targetDuration":4,"studyType":166,"phases":4,"briefSummary":167,"conditions":168,"keywords":172,"overallStatus":39,"whyStopped":4,"lastUpdateSubmitDate":174,"lastUpdatePostDateStruct":175,"startDateStruct":176,"completionDateStruct":178,"leadSponsor":180,"locationsCount":102},"100619345","effect-of-anesthesia-technique-on-surgical-view-in-shoulder-arthroscopy-100619345","NCT07343414","Effect of Anesthesia Technique on Surgical View in Shoulder Arthroscopy","Impact of Anesthesia Method on Surgical View and Surgeon Satisfaction During Shoulder Arthroscopy: A Prospective Observational Study","Inclusion Criteria:\n\n* Volunteers aged 18 to 75 years.\n* Patients scheduled for elective shoulder arthroscopy.\n* Patients with an ASA (American Society of Anesthesiologists) physical status score of I, II, or III.\n* Patients capable of providing informed consent.\n\nExclusion Criteria:\n\n* Previous surgical procedure performed on the same shoulder.\n* Presence of medical contraindications that could affect the choice of anesthesia (coagulopathy, active infection, severe pulmonary diseases)\n* Known allergy to local anesthetics or general anesthesia agents\n* History of opioid dependence or chronic pain syndrome\n* Presence of neurological disorders, particularly those involving the brachial plexus",{"count":165,"type":22},82,"OBSERVATIONAL","This prospective observational study evaluates the effect of the anesthesia method (general anesthesia versus regional anesthesia \\[interscalene nerve block\u002Fsuperficial cervical block\\] with sedation) on the operating clarity of the surgical view and the surgeon's satisfaction during elective shoulder arthroscopy. The study investigates how these different anesthesia techniques influence intraoperative conditions, specifically bleeding amounts and the visibility of the surgical field, which are critical for the success of this minimally invasive procedure. Additionally, the research will monitor patient-centered outcomes, including postoperative pain levels, recovery time, and potential side effects such as nausea or vomiting, to determine which anesthesia strategy provides the optimal balance of surgical efficiency and patient comfort.",[29,169,170,171],"Interscalene Nerve Block","Surgical View Quality","Surgeon Satisfaction",[29,171,170,169,173],"Rotator Cuff Repair","2026-01-07",{"date":152,"type":43},{"date":177,"type":22},"2026-02-01",{"date":179,"type":22},"2027-05-01",{"name":181,"class":71},"Amasya University",{"id":183,"slug":184,"hasResults":11,"nctId":185,"briefTitle":186,"officialTitle":186,"acronym":4,"eligibilityCriteria":187,"healthyVolunteers":188,"sex":17,"minAge":4,"maxAge":4,"enrollmentInfo":189,"targetDuration":4,"studyType":166,"phases":4,"briefSummary":191,"conditions":192,"keywords":4,"overallStatus":39,"whyStopped":4,"lastUpdateSubmitDate":193,"lastUpdatePostDateStruct":194,"startDateStruct":196,"completionDateStruct":198,"leadSponsor":200,"locationsCount":102},"100558589","development-of-the-surgeon-satisfaction-self-assessment-questionnaire-for-shoulder-arthroscopy-100558589","NCT06553079","Development of the Surgeon Satisfaction Self-Assessment Questionnaire for Shoulder Arthroscopy","Inclusion Criteria:\n\n* Orthopedic Surgeons:Must be a licensed orthopedic surgeon actively performing shoulder arthroscopy procedures.\n* Participants must be willing to provide informed consent and participate in both the questionnaire development (including interviews) and the validation phases of the study.\n* Participants must be proficient in the language in which the questionnaire is administered to ensure accurate and meaningful responses.\n\nExclusion Criteria:\n\n\\-",true,{"count":190,"type":22},30,"This observational study aims to develop and validate the \"Surgeon Satisfaction Self-Assessment Questionnaire for Shoulder Arthroscopy.\" The study involves conducting in-depth interviews with surgeons who perform shoulder arthroscopy to identify key factors influencing their surgical satisfaction, including individual, patient-related, and surgical equipment-related factors. Based on the insights gained from these interviews, a comprehensive questionnaire will be developed. The questionnaire will then undergo validation processes, including assessments of content, construct, criterion, and reliability, to ensure it accurately and consistently measures surgeon satisfaction. The final validated tool is intended to provide a reliable method for surgeons to self-assess their satisfaction with shoulder arthroscopy procedures, contributing to improved surgical practices and outcomes.",[171,29],"2024-08-10",{"date":195,"type":43},"2024-08-14",{"date":197,"type":22},"2024-09-01",{"date":199,"type":22},"2025-03-01",{"name":201,"class":71},"Gazi University"]
